sec-Butylamine (CAS: 13952-84-6), with the chemical formula CH3CH2CH(NH2)CH3, is a volatile and flammable primary amine. It is a key organic building block utilised in chemical synthesis. Its primary applications stem from its role as an intermediate in the production of various organic compounds, particularly pharmaceuticals and agrochemicals. 01 /Applications

Pharmaceutical Intermediate

sec-Butylamine serves as a crucial intermediate in the synthesis of active pharmaceutical ingredients (APIs). Its amine functional group allows for diverse chemical modifications essential in drug discovery and manufacturing.

Agrochemical Synthesis

It is employed in the production of pesticides and herbicides. The incorporation of the sec-butyl group can influence the efficacy and environmental profile of agricultural chemicals.

Organic Synthesis Building Block

As a versatile C4 amine, it functions as a fundamental building block in complex organic syntheses, enabling the introduction of the sec-butyl moiety into target molecules.

Corrosion Inhibitors

Derivatives of sec-butylamine can be utilised in the formulation of corrosion inhibitors, particularly in industrial applications where metal protection is critical.

02 /Properties
Molecular weight73.14
Linear formulaCH3CH2CH(NH2)CH3
Assay99%
Boiling point63 °C(lit.)
Density0.724 g/mL at 25 °C(lit.)
Refractive indexn20/D 1.3928(lit.)
Melting point−72 °C(lit.)
03 /Safety & handling
GHS hazard pictogram: Flammable (GHS02)
Flammable
GHS hazard pictogram: Corrosive (GHS05)
Corrosive
GHS hazard pictogram: Toxic (GHS06)
Toxic
GHS hazard pictogram: Environmental hazard (GHS09)
Environmental hazard
Danger

Hazard statements

  • H225Highly flammable liquid and vapour
  • H301Toxic if swallowed
  • H314Causes severe skin burns and eye damage
  • H332Harmful if inhaled
  • H410Very toxic to aquatic life with long-lasting effects

Precautionary statements

  • P210Keep away from heat, sparks and open flames. No smoking
  • P273Avoid release to the environment
  • P280Wear protective gloves, clothing and eye/face protection
  • P301IF SWALLOWED
  • P305IF IN EYES
  • P310Immediately call a POISON CENTER or doctor
Protective equipmentFaceshields, full-face respirator (US), Gloves, Goggles, multi-purpose combination respirator cartridge (US)
Flash point-19 °C / -2.2 °F
Transport (UN / ADR)UN 2733 3/PG 2
Water hazard class (WGK, DE)2
Hazard codes (EU)F,C,N
Risk statements (R)11-20/22-35-50
Safety statements (S)9-16-26-28-36/37/39-45-61
